From: Kotresh HR Date: Tue, 16 Jun 2026 17:31:13 +0000 (+0530) Subject: qa: Add tests for cephfs_mirror_directory perf counters X-Git-Url: http://git-server-git.apps.pok.os.sepia.ceph.com/?a=commitdiff_plain;h=3fc6457a8f77c9916476224c278fa8a6b6a8ceb1;p=ceph.git qa: Add tests for cephfs_mirror_directory perf counters Verify counter dump registration, current-sync gauges while syncing (full/delta), last-sync and summary counters after idle sync, and extend mirror stats and remote-snap failure tests for per-directory snaps_* and dir_state.
